Are you a graduate keen to support pupils through the most important stage of primary education?*** KS2 Academic Coach*** September 2025 – July 2026*** £81–£102 per day*** Location: Wolverhampton*** Academic support across the KS2 National CurriculumThe RoleAs a KS2 Academic Coach, you'll work with pupils across Years 3 to 6, delivering 1:1 and small group academic interventions in core subjects. You’ll help close learning gaps, boost confidence, and prepare pupils for SATs. Working closely with class teachers, you’ll adapt materials, monitor progress, and support classroom routines to keep learning on track.The CandidateYou’re a graduate with a strong academic background and a genuine interest in education. You should be confident working with children aged 7–11 and able to explain concepts clearly and simply. Previous experience working with young people—whether in a school, tutoring or mentoring role—is highly desirable. This role is ideal for anyone considering primary teaching.The SchoolThis Wolverhampton primary school is well-respected for its academic rigour and inclusive ethos. Staff support and invest in graduate talent, offering clear guidance and regular feedback.
